Sony Pictures Home Entertainment is preparing a Blu-ray release of Fred F. Sears'
Rock Around the Clock (1956), starring Bill Haley and the Comets, The Platters, Ernie Freeman Combo, Tony Martinez and His Band, and Alan Freed. The release is scheduled to arrive on the market on October 24.
Description: Agent Steve Hollis (Johnny Johnston) and his bass playing pal Corny (Henry Slate) quit their big band gigs and hit the road, where they happen upon Haley and his band in a Podunk farming town. Although they don't quite know what to make of the Comets' music ("It isn't boogie, it isn't jive, it isn't swing… it's kinda all of 'em!"), they know a hot prospect when they find one and promise to secure them a legitimate shot at the big time. Complications ensue, including romantic ones. Haley and his band are on fire; they're lip-syncing, but the recordings of "See You Later Alligator," the title tune, and others are filled with snap and crackle, the musicians are great, the stage show is a riot, and the dancing siblings are amazing.
